Conflenti to Rome - Language, Currency, Distance, How to Reach, Expenses, Best time to go, What to Eat, Where to Go, FAQ

Conflenti is a small town in the province of Catanzaro, Calabria, Italy. Rome is the capital of Italy and one of the most popular tourist destinations in the world.

Language

The official language of both Conflenti and Rome is Italian.

Currency

The official currency of both Conflenti and Rome is the Euro.

Distance

The distance between Conflenti and Rome is approximately 480 kilometers (300 miles).

How to Reach

There are several ways to reach Rome from Conflenti:

  • By car: The drive from Conflenti to Rome takes approximately 6 hours.
  • By train: There are several trains that run from Conflenti to Rome each day. The journey takes approximately 5 hours.
  • By bus: There are several buses that run from Conflenti to Rome each day. The journey takes approximately 7 hours.

Expenses

The cost of traveling from Conflenti to Rome will vary depending on the mode of transportation and the time of year.

  • By car: The cost of petrol and tolls will vary depending on the route taken.
  • By train: The cost of a train ticket from Conflenti to Rome starts at €20.
  • By bus: The cost of a bus ticket from Conflenti to Rome starts at €15.

Best time to go

The best time to visit Rome is during the shoulder months (April-May and September-October) when the weather is mild and there are fewer tourists.
